Shopping for a Wedding
Veil
When you’re shopping for your wedding veil you will
find that there are a number of different styles and lengths
to choose from, made in a variety of materials, including
bridal illusion, tulle, English netting and chiffon.
Veils are also available in one, two or more tiers or layers,
of the same or varying lengths; but bear in mind that several
layers of netting can become quite opaque and may hide any
fine detail on your wedding gown. In addition, you may come
across the word ‘blusher’. This is a single layer
of veiling which covers the face, and an optional element
of a bridal veil.
Your choice of veil may also depend, to a degree, on the
length and style of your wedding dress. For example, if your
wedding gown is very ornate then as a general rule a plainer
veil will best complement it. Whereas a wedding dress of a
simpler design will harmonize beautifully with either an ornate
or plain bridal veil.
